>> I was recently approached by a game programmer who was interested in

>> recreating game development environments used by game developers in the

>> 80s

>> and 90s, etc. Or as he called them, "asset creation environments."

>>

>

> Such environments are extremely specific to the dev house and project. A

> good example can be found in the Making of The 7th Guest video that was a

> pack-in that came with the game; they used 3ds plus custom compression tools

> written by Devine. While you can always get a 486 and load it with 1993-era

> 3DS, those compression tools are most likely lost.
